Security Cards. Employees continuously reporting to work without their card will be required to retrieve their card on their own time and report to work. Damaged cards will be replaced at no cost to the employee. First lost card per year will be replaced at no cost to the employee. For each subsequent lost card, employees will be charged five ($5.00) dollars per card in that year. If a lost card is found, the employees will be reimbursed for the loss of the card. Employees shall have their card in their possession at all times if required.

Security Cards. 18.3.6.1 The Security Cards Charge consists of a charge per five (5) new cards or replacement cards, for access cards, and ID cards. Rates and charges are as found in the Collocation Rate Summary. AT&T-13STATE will issue access cards and/or ID cards within twenty- one (21) days of receipt of a complete and accurate AT&T Photo ID Card and Electronic Access for Collocators and Associated Contractors form, which is located on the telecommunications carrier online website xxxxx://xxxx.xxx.xxx/clec. In emergency or other extenuating circumstances (but not in the normal course of business), Collocator may request that the twenty-one (21) day interval be expedited, and AT&T-13STATE will issue the access and/or ID cards as soon as reasonably practical. There is an additional charge for expedited requests.

Security Cards. 26.1 Subtenant's access to the Building will be controlled by Sublandlord's security system, which requires a security card to be displayed before entrance into the Building will be granted. Subtenant shall pay to Sublandlord the sum of $10.00 for each security card required for each employee of Subtenant who requires entrance into the Building. In the event that any security card is lost, misplaced or damaged, Subtenant will pay to Sublandlord $10.00 for a replacement of such security card. Notwithstanding the foregoing, Subtenant may, at Subtenant's sole cost and expense, install and maintain its own security system controlling access to the Premises; provided (a) that Subtenant gives Sublandlord and Overlandlord security cards or other items or information necessary to allow such parties to have access to the Premises for the purposes permitted under this Sublease and the Overxxxxx; xxd (b) that such security system shall be solely on the Premises and shall not in any manner affect access to any other areas of the Building or the Leased Space.

Security Cards. During non-regular business hours, entry to the Building and the parking structure is presently provided by a 24 hour security guard. Landlord may hereafter elect its agents and employees for purposes of providing entry to the Building and/or parking structure and/or to services within the Building (including without limitation elevator service and HVAC systems) during non-regular business hours. In the event a security card(s) issued to Tenant is lost or stolen, Tenant shall immediately report such loss to Landlord. Tenant shall be solely responsible and accountable to Landlord for each security card issued to Tenant and shall pay to Landlord a security deposit for each security card issued to Tenant, in an amount not to exceed $25.00 per card. Tenant shall pay for all charges, fees or expenses for services provided by reason of the use of any security card issued to Tenant, until the earlier of: (i) return of the security card to the Landlord; or (b) twenty-four (24) hours after Tenant's written report to Landlord of the loss of such card. Tenant shall further pay for and defend, indemnify and hold Landlord harmless from and against any claim, liability, damage, loss, cost or expense (including reasonable attorneys' fees) resulting by reason of the actions of any person(s) who gains entry to the Building during non-regular business hours by use of security card issued to Tenant which has not been reported as lost or stolen. The number of security cards provided by Landlord to Tenant shall be determined by Landlord on a reasonable basis. Any additional or replacement security cards shall be provided to Tenant at Tenant's expense.

Security Cards. To facilitate the Tenant’s ingress and egress into the Demised Premises and into RamRe House during Restricted Hours, the Landlord shall at its expense provide the Tenant and employees of the Tenant with Security Cards provided that the Tenant shall reimburse the Landlord for the reasonable cost of any new, additional, lost, damaged and/or replacement Security Cards which shall be returned upon Termination (all lost Security Cards to be reported immediately to the Landlord). A minimum of twenty four (24) hours notice to be given to the Landlord for the request of any new, additional, and/or replacement Security Cards.
